Voodoo

The fol­low­ers of Voo­doo are a rebel­li­ous, aggress­ive people. Not want­ing to sub­mit to West­ern Xia, they live north of the great wall and rely on their own ten­a­cious spirit to sur­vive away from main­stream society.

Though they are not often the strongest, they are often the most feared war­ri­ors in battle. Their impec­cable spirit defence makes them tough adversar­ies, and their nat­ur­ally aggress­ive nature makes them more than will­ing to try and prove them­selves in battle against other classes.

Voo­doo Philosophy

For a rebel­li­ous people, the war­ri­ors of Voo­doo are remark­ably devout. They wor­ship their leader Mas­ter Ting as a god, and for all their mys­ter­i­ous prac­tices have an extremely close con­nec­tion with the Spirit world, for through it they are able to gain greater power.

As befits their close asso­ci­ation with nature and the Spirit world, the war­ri­ors of Voo­doo take their philo­sophy very ser­i­ously. The five divine creatures — snakes, scor­pi­ons, clams, centi­pedes and geckos — are all cent­ral parts of the Voo­doo belief sys­tem, and though to out­siders their goals may seem eldritch and mys­ti­fy­ing, those who know Voo­doo well can attest to the holy aspir­a­tions of this most inter­est­ing of classes.

Voo­doo Sea

The gloomy lands south of Dun Huang are notori­ously hos­tile, ren­der­ing them almost inhab­it­able to nor­mal human beings. Here, amidst the dan­ger­ous flora and fauna of the rich and var­ied oasis, the Voo­doo class has made its home. With its abund­ance of venom­ous creatures, and its calm, mys­tical serenity, the Voo­doo Sea is the per­fect loc­a­tion for Voo­doo war­ri­ors to prac­tice their arcane arts of poison-​craft safe from the influ­ence of the out­side world.

Class Char­ac­ter­ist­ics

With their home set deep in the heart of the inhos­pit­able Voo­doo Sea, it is no won­der that the war­ri­ors of Voo­doo should seek to make use of the abund­ant resources their home has to offer. From the earli­est days of their ini­ti­ation, every Voo­doo war­rior trains in the art of poison mak­ing until they are mas­ters of their art. It is this intense ded­ic­a­tion to their art-​form that means the fol­low­ers of Voo­doo have an unsur­passed level of poison-​craft that not even the Beg­gars’ Alli­ance can hope to match.

Com­bat Characteristics

The fol­low­ers of Voo­doo may not neces­sar­ily be the strongest war­ri­ors in a battle, but they are often the most fright­en­ing. As befits a class that spends much of its time craft­ing pois­ons, the Voo­doo style of mar­tial arts focuses heav­ily on the use of poison attacks. When com­bined with their nat­ur­ally high magical defence, this makes war­ri­ors of Voo­doo very tough opponents.

Like their com­bat style, their magic is also equally power­ful. The Voo­doo practitioner’s intense con­nec­tion to the Spirit world allows them to inflict dam­age through their ghostly min­ions, and cast power­ful curses on their enemies which drain health over time. Blood is required to speak with the Voo­doo gods, so they ride a Yak which can be sac­ri­ficed if there are no enemies nearby.

Class Over­view

  • Highest HP of all the magical classes
  • Skills are dif­fi­cult to learn
  • Skills con­tain many dif­fer­ent side effects, such as drain­ing and blinding
  • Even if no skill is used, oppon­ents who comes in con­tact with a Voo­doo war­rior are often poisoned naturally
  • Can sac­ri­fice HP in order to recover MP
